To thrive as an SQL Financial Analyst, you need strong analytical abilities, proficiency in financial modeling, and advanced SQL skills, typically supported by a degree in finance, accounting, or a related field. Experience with data visualization tools (such as Tableau or Power BI), ERP systems, and relevant certifications like CFA or Microsoft SQL Server certification are highly valuable. Attention to detail, critical thinking, and effective communication are important soft skills for collaborating with colleagues and presenting findings. These capabilities are essential for interpreting complex financial data, driving actionable insights, and supporting sound business decisions.